Unless one exists already, I've checked and I couldn't find one that did this.

Main point of this plugin if it was ever created, help with dealing with auto breeders and over breeders.

My main suggestion or way of this plugin: Admins of the server could use a command, for example, "/unclaimeddinos" or "cheat unclaimeddinos" and it could pop up in chat, showing all dinos that are unclaimed in a customizable foundation radius (default could be 3x3) that counts all other unclaimed dinos in that range, and displays the LAT and LON position next to it.

An example in chat of what it could look like:

(UNCLAIMEDDINOS) 7 Unclaimed "Pteranodon" at position 41 LAT 67 LON
or if there are multiple dino types in a spot
(UNCLAIMEDDINOS) 4 Unclaimed "Paracertherium" 9 Unclaimed "Pteranodon" at position 58 LAT 85 LON


If this could ever be done, that would be great, or if there is already a plugin that can check for unclaimed or prevent unclaimed dinos from over breeding, could a link be provided?
